随着互联网的发展,小程序成为越来越多商家的选择,而水果店铺小程序的开发也具有很大的潜力。水果店铺小程序开发可以帮助商家实现线上线下的融合,提升品牌影响力和用户体验,从而更好地满足消费者的需求。
需求分析
水果店铺小程序需要实现以下功能:
1. 商品展示:展示水果商品,包括图片、价格、品种等信息。
2. 在线购物:用户可以在小程序中添加商品到购物车,并选择配送地址和配送时间。
3. 订单管理:用户可以查看、修改、取消订单。
4. 支付功能:支持微信支付、支付宝支付等多种支付方式。
5. 客服沟通:提供客服联系方式,方便用户咨询和反馈。
技术要点:
1. 采用微信小程序开发框架,使用WXML、WXSS、JavaScript技术实现。
2. 使用云服务实现数据存储和业务逻辑处理,如腾讯云、阿里云等。
3. 使用第三方物流配送平台实现配送功能,如美团配送、饿了么配送等。
前端设计
水果店铺小程序的前端界面设计应该符合用户体验要求,简洁明了,易于操作。以下是前端界面的设计要点:
1.首页:展示热门商品、推荐商品、新品上市等栏目,增加用户点击和购买欲望。
2.商品列表页:展示所有商品信息,包括图片、价格、品种等,方便用户浏览和选择。
3.购物车页:展示用户已添加的商品信息,包括数量、价格等,方便用户修改和结算。
4.订单页:展示用户的订单信息,包括订单号、购买时间、购买商品等。
5.支付页:展示订单信息,提供多种支付方式,如微信支付、支付宝支付等。
后端开发
水果店铺小程序的后端逻辑架构应该稳定可靠,易于扩展,能够满足高并发访问的要求。以下是后端开发的要点:
1. 数据存储:采用云数据库存储用户信息、商品信息、订单信息等数据,保证数据安全可靠。
2. 业务逻辑处理:实现商品查询、添加、删除、修改等操作,实现订单生成、修改、取消等操作,实现支付处理等业务逻辑。
3. 接口开发:与前端界面交互,实现数据传递和业务处理,如商品列表接口、购物车接口、订单接口、支付接口等。
4. 实现权限控制:对不同用户角色进行权限控制,保证数据安全和业务逻辑的正确性。
测试与上线
水果店铺小程序需要进行充分的测试,包括功能测试、性能测试、安全测试等,以保证小程序的稳定性和可靠性。测试完成后,可以将小程序提交到微信开放平台进行审核,审核通过后即可上线。
上线后需要进行持续的维护和优化,保证小程序的稳定性和用户体验。同时,需要根据用户反馈和业务需求进行不断的改进和升级,以满足不断变化的用户需求和市场环境。
总结:水果店铺小程序的开发需要充分考虑用户需求和市场环境,从需求分析、前端设计、后端开发、测试与上线等方面进行全面考虑和实现。通过小程序的开发,可以帮助商家实现线上线下的融合,提升品牌影响力和用户体验,满足消费者的需求,提高销售业绩。